As I’m sure is the case for many of you, 40 hours of your week are spent in a not-so-stylish office wor cubical. I am one of those (lucky?) people. A few months ago I asked to move to the front office…which has a window! Windows are hard to come by in many offices so this is a BIG deal.
Although the window alone does a ton for my office, I have added a few other small things to spruce up my space.
First, I bought a couple place mats from Target. They have added color, warmth, and interest to my little workplace.
Secondly, pictures! Because, who doesn’t love pictures? This is a simple way to add some cute frames and the people you love most to your desk.
I also threw in a flea-market-find dictionary for a little something extra. (Please pardon the florescent glare. The struggle is real.)
Next, a lamp. This is such a quick and easy mood fix to the florescent world in which I spend hours each day. Plus, I adore lamps. I found this $10 lamp at the one and only, you guessed it, Target. (I promise I shop other places, too…sometimes :)).
And, my favorite part…the personal touches.
I gave you a preview earlier, but here is the close-up of the floral “H” my sweet sissy made me for my birthday.
Finally, this elephant was something my dad bought my grandma when he went to India. When she passed away, it was one of the keepsakes that I was able to add to my home. It constantly reminds me of my grandmother and dad. Two people I am proud & thankful to call family.
One day I will have a home office where I will get to pick out every single detail. But for now, this is a pretty good compromise.
